Modi in Moscow next monthRajiv Shah, TNN 17 September 2009, 02:13am
ISTGANDHINAGAR:
The Russian government has invited chief minister Narendra Modi to visit
Moscow to attend the Fourth International Energy Week, to be held in the
last week of October 2009. Officials said the CM will take along with him a
trade delegation to attend the event to be held at the World Trade Centre,
Moscow.

Russia is not an EU country and Modi visited Moscow in July 2006 on his way
to Astrakhan. Officials say Modi is keen on being in Moscow next month as he
wants to promote Gujarat as the `Gas Capital' of India. Already, Gujarat
consumes nearly 40 per cent of the total gas requirements of the country and
has written to the Centre that it wants more.

After visiting Moscow, Modi may go to Astrakhan, a tiny Russian province on
the banks of Caspian Sea. Modi signed a protocol of understanding with
Astrakhan government in November 2001, when he visited Moscow with then
Prime Minister A B Vajpayee. Another protocol of cooperation was signed
during Modi's visit to Astrakhan in July 2006.

Significantly, Modi has not been able to visit any European Union country
ever since he was refused visa to US in March 2005 on grounds of human
rights violations during the 2002 communal riots. Another reason for visa
denial was the anti-conversion law, stiffly opposed by Christian human
rights groups.
